> The condition to check that Brooklyn is up is wrong.  This means that when
> calling vagrant up, the Brooklyn node is created, but the command never
> ends, and the other nodes are not created.
>
> In files/install_brooklyn.sh, Brooklyn being successfully up is checked by
> the presence of the "BundleEvent STARTED - org.apache.brooklyn.karaf-init”
> statement in the Brooklyn.debug.log file.
>
> But that statement is not part of the log.

> [X] QuickLaunch template errors:
> - The 2-bash-server-template contains an error in line 13. The apt-get
> install command is called without the -Y argument. This means that the VM
> is not configured correctly since it is stuck waiting a confirmation.
> - Template 3-bash-web-and-riak-template cannot be deployed on an Ubuntu 18
> AWS machine. The error message is  E: Unable to locate package riak.
> - Template 4-resilient-bash-web-cluster-template cannot be deployed on an
> Ubuntu 18 AWS machine, because of compile error while building nginx-1.8.0.
